> This is just a quick announcement that we have now branched off v7.1.x
> from the main development tree, and are starting to dive into development
> of v7.2 ...
> 
> There have been several changes since v7.1 was released, including:
> 
> Fix for numeric MODULO operator (Tom)
> pg_dump fixes (Philip)
> pg_dump can dump 7.0 databases (Philip)
> readline 4.2 fixes (Peter E)
> JOIN fixes (Tom)
> AIX, MSWIN, VAX,N32K fixes (Tom)
> Multibytes fixes (Tom)
> Unicode fixes (Tatsuo)
> Optimizer improvements (Tom)
> Fix for whole tuples in functions (Tom)
> Fix for pg_ctl and option strings with spaces (Peter E)
> ODBC fixes (Hiroshi)
> EXTRACT can now take string argument (Thomas)
> Python fixes (Darcy)
> 
> With more details available in the ChangeLog file ...
> 
> This release does not require a dump/restore from v7.1, it is purely a
> maintaince release ...

Lieven Van Acker <[EMAIL PROTECTED]> writes:
> Are the "nested views permission problems" fixed in this release?
> If so, a dump IS necessary because of a change rule creation routines.

If you're running into that issue, you might want to drop and recreate
the affected views/rules.  That's a far cry from a database dump and
reload, though.  At least for them as has gigabytes of data ;-)
